Output 30c9ac2869e6a1377153617b589b0a801b574022315e647c00f8e288e0f54dcd:7

value
175018380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04dccac6a93be006f8920d77639efcd374dc500 OP_EQUAL
address
3GJdEqjZaj9bBa8QfRwKpxvSZeCuUocybP
transaction
30c9ac2869e6a1377153617b589b0a801b574022315e647c00f8e288e0f54dcd
spent
true